This is probably a bug.
I have imported nushares wallet to the B&C wallet (3.00-RC2-beta 32bit win) and been minting for a few days. After I imported I see 8 addresses, in Receive pane. named “Converted Nushares” corresponding to the number of address I had in the NSR wallet. This is all fine.
Today I see almost 200 addresses in “Receive”, all named “Converted Nushares”. I checked a few them in the console they are all valid and belonging to me. The getinfo output is this

Note that the keypoolsize is 101, much less than the number in the “Receive” pane. I guess these new address could be generated from minting (then every block would generate more than 3 addresses) or somehow the nushares wallet was imported like more than 20 times. Actually I just restarted the wallet and the number of address does seem to increase (it’s hard to count accurately now. Is there a command to show named addresses in Receive?)
edit: I find an easier way to count. There are 208 addresses and the number doesn’t increase when restarting the wallet.
